This research was conducted to approach solving problems of psychological and environmental factors of hearing impaired athletes related to career by counseling. Sample athlete was consisted of one 32-year-old professional acquired hearing impaired level 2-sprinter, and the research tried to report the effective cases based on Rogers" anthropocentric counseling technique. A sign language was used as the counseling method and psychological characteristics were analyzed from resulting documentations of the process. This research tried to allocate enough time through research field work, counseling session, and formation of rapport for reliability and credibility of the data. In addition, multianglular analysis was used to secure the reliability of the data. Sample athlete"s psychological problems were lack of motivation and confidence, and behavioral problems were difficulties during training session due to the absence of communication with supervisors and coaches. Counseling results to solve those problems were; firstly, counseling had positive effects on athlete"s low level of motivation and confidence, and secondly, counseling showed positive effects on athlete"s behavioral problems such as relationships with supervisors and coaches, and difficulties during training sessions. With these counseling results analyzed to approach solving problems through athlete"s verbal reactions, and counseling suggested affecting positive impacts on hearing impaired athlete"s psychological problems.
